About Apotex Inc.

Apotex is a Canadian-based global health company. We improve everyday access to affordable, innovative medicines and health products for millions of people worldwide, with a broad portfolio of generic, biosimilar, innovative branded pharmaceuticals and consumer health products. Headquartered in Toronto, with regional offices globally, including in the United States, Mexico and India, we are the largest Canadian-based pharmaceutical company and a health partner of choice for the Americas for pharmaceutical licensing and product acquisitions.

Job Summary

Responsible to coordinate, plan and execute activities to support the New Product Launch process in achieving successful product launches.

Serves as an intermediate technical specialist for New Product Launch; dealing with Apotex executives and management with customized or complex professional services related to New Product Launches.

Collaborate with counterparts in Sales & Marketing, R&D and Operations, throughout the new product launch process to achieve on time in full successful launches.

Job Responsibilities

  • Generate all required SAP codes and Master Recipes for new product launches and line extensions, for the purposes of capacity and component planning, prior to submission.
  • Generate change requests for MPaR (Master Packaging Record) for new product launches following submission stage or creation of projects for line extensions.  As required, generate change requests for MMaR (Master Manufacturing Record), CofAs, and Test Profiles.
  • Generate change requests to create or review/approve finished good, semi-finished, packaging component and unique excipient codes in SAP following Submission stage.
